The first thing we must do for this case is to find the conversion of rupees to US dollars.

Currently, the conversion is:

1 rupee = 0.014 $

Then, to find the amount of $ in 2000 rupees, we make the following rule of three:

1 rupee -----------------> 0.014 $

2000 rupees ----------> x

From here, we clear the value of x.

We have then:

[tex] x = (2000) * (0.014)  x = 28  [/tex]

Answer:

2,000 rupees are 28 US dollars.
